Internet Kraken posted:

Regardless, its pretty ridiculous to act like Mcree's flashbang is something that can be avoided through ~skill~. It has a large radius and fast animation, and more importantly if you get hit anywhere in that radius you eat the full stun. Mcree doesn't have to be precise with his aiming of flashbang, its too fast and large for someone up close to be able to avoid it. It'd be a lot less frustrating if the duration scaled based on how close to the center you were, so that aiming is actually an issue and you won't get fanned because some idiot Mcree caught you with the very edge of it.

I agree with this for both flashbang and mei ult. It doesn't need a huge falloff but if mcree stun was cut in half at max range, or if mei freeze took an extra second if you were on the outskirts of the ult it would feel a bit better.
